Google Maps vs. Windows Live Search Smackdown!
There are quite a few online mapping/driving directions programs out there. When it comes to maps on Windows Mobile devices, however, the two main contenders are Google Maps Mobile and Windows Live Search (of course, without the assistance of a GPS, that is).
The question is frequently asked, which is better. Until now, my answer has typically been to try both and decide which one works best for you. This is generally considered a safe and generic way of saying, “I have no freaking clue.” Until now…
Earlier this week, Dwight Silverman of TechBlog put Google Maps and Windows Live Search to the test in a head-to-head, winner-take-all smackdown. Dwight puts both programs through their paces. Which one comes out on top? Well, you might be surprised to learn that it was not the one you might have expected (I think Yogi Berra said that).
Check out Techblog to read the full smackdown and see who one (via JKontherun).
